Requirements

  • Bachelor's or Master's in Supply Chain Management, Industrial Engineering, Logistics, Analytics/Planning, or other related majors
  • Minimum of one internship in a Supply Chain related role
  • Recent graduates or early career professionals with less than 2 years of professional experience (including internship/co-op experience)
  • Demonstrated leadership values & behaviors, and core professional skills such as critical thinking, problem-solving, learning agility, and accountability
  • Software/Program experience preferred: Microsoft Office Suite, SAP, DeepHow, Tulip
  • Passion and curiosity for function and industry with the ability to effectively communicate ideas and build relationships
  • Willingness to rotate work assignments, projects, and teams every 8 months throughout the program; relocation required

Responsibilities

  • Build core professional skills and competencies in Supply Chain Planning, Procurement, Manufacturing & Distribution
  • Participate in three 8-month rotations over two years, gaining exposure to different businesses and facilities across the United States
  • Network with Program Team, C-Suite Executives, SLP Peers, SLP Alumni, GSC Leadership & Business Partners
  • Contribute to the success of assigned facilities during rotations
